About G3D Mark
G3D Mark is a standard benchmark that measures graphics performance in real-world gaming scenarios. It simplifies comparing cards from different brands, where higher scores directly correlate with better fps and smoother gaming experiences.

GeForce 705M
The GeForce 705M is manufactured by NVIDIA. It was released in October 27 2015. It features the Maxwell architecture. The core clock ranges from 928 MHz to 1020 MHz. It has 640 shading units. The thermal design power (TDP) is 75W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 456 points.

GeForce 8800 GT
The GeForce 8800 GT is manufactured by NVIDIA. It was released in July 15 2008. It features the G9x architecture. The core clock speed is 500 MHz. It has 224 shading units. The thermal design power (TDP) is 150W. Manufactured using 65 nm process technology. G3D Mark benchmark score: 457 points.
